Per the link, the current committed delegate count is:
Romney=844
Santorum=260
Gingrich=179
Paul=79
There are 1144 delegates needed to clinch and 965 delegates still not selected or committed. The formula to determine percent of remaining delegates needed to clinch is 1144 - SD divided by 965 where SD = secured delegates.
Thus, Newt is 1144-137/965 or 104.4%. Newt still can not win even if he secures 100% of remaining delegates.
Santorum is at 91.6%, Romney is now at 31.1%.
Even if Newt, Santorum and Paul teamed up, they would have 477 delegates. You can do the math on how many they would need:
1144-477/965.
It just isn't going to happen.
